Mole Attack

Mole Attack is a video game for the Commodore VIC-20.

Plot

Moles pop up from nine holes, and the player has 60 seconds to send them fleeing back underground by bopping them on the head with a hammer.[1]

Gameplay

Players have the option of using a joystick to position the hammer, but can also use a keyboard.[1]

Reception

Electronic Games reviewed Mole Attack in 1983 by Charlene Komar. The reviewer commented: "Mole Attack will probably be a favorite among younger arcaders. Even though the eye-catching graphics combine well with the time-limit excitement, adults will probably find the game too simple and repetitive to get too many repeat plays."[1]
